Lagrange polynomial interpolation is particularly convenient when the same values V0, V1, ... Vn are repeatevely used in several applications. The data values can be stored in computer memory and number of computations can thus be reduced. Limitations of the Lagrange interpolation occur when additional data points are added or removed to improve the appearance of the interpolating curve.
